EIFFL vs SHINDL: Stock Comparison

Euro India Fresh Foods Limited vs Sharat Industries LtdUpdated 22 Jun 26, 4:08 PM ISTNSE & company filings

Sharat Industries Ltd is the larger company by market capitalisation. Euro India Fresh Foods Limited shows faster revenue growth and a higher net margin, while Sharat Industries Ltd shows a lower P/E, a higher ROE and a higher dividend yield. These are relative readings on individual metrics — weigh valuation against growth, margins, leverage and capital efficiency rather than treating any single number as decisive.
